Job Description
The position involves applying expertise in finance, accounting, and economics to analyze complex legal and regulatory issues, develop financial models, and produce expert reports to support litigation and regulatory proceedings, primarily focusing on economic damages, valuation disputes, and market analysis.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and analyze complex economic and financial models to support litigation and regulatory matters
- Guide programming, model building, and statistical analysis using tools like Stata, SAS, R, or Python
- Draw conclusions and generate insights from data analysis for reports and client presentations
- Draft and present expert reports summarizing opinions, conclusions, and recommendations
- Interact directly with clients, attorneys, industry professionals, and government entities on finance and economics issues
- Assist regulators and financial institutions with analysis of trading activities in markets
- Ensure the accuracy and integrity of economic analyses and opinions
- Supervise, coach, and delegate work to junior analysts
- Identify potential project revenue opportunities and contribute to practice development activities
